"""Models describing relationships between people."""
import typing
from django.db import models
from django.urls import reverse
from .person import Organisation, Person
from .question import AnswerSet, Question, QuestionChoice
__all__ = [
'RelationshipQuestion',
'RelationshipQuestionChoice',
'RelationshipAnswerSet',
'Relationship',
'OrganisationRelationshipQuestion',
'OrganisationRelationshipQuestionChoice',
'OrganisationRelationshipAnswerSet',
'OrganisationRelationship',
]
class RelationshipQuestion(Question):
"""Question which may be asked about a relationship."""
class RelationshipQuestionChoice(QuestionChoice):
"""Allowed answer to a :class:`RelationshipQuestion`."""
#: Question to which this answer belongs
question = models.ForeignKey(RelationshipQuestion,
related_name='answers',
on_delete=models.CASCADE,
blank=False,
null=False)
class Meta(QuestionChoice.Meta):
constraints = [
models.UniqueConstraint(fields=['question', 'text'],
name='unique_question_answer_relationshipquestionchoice')
]
class Relationship(models.Model):
"""A directional relationship between two people allowing linked questions."""
class Meta:
constraints = [
models.UniqueConstraint(fields=['source', 'target'],
name='unique_relationship_modelrelationship'),
]
#: Person reporting the relationship
source = models.ForeignKey(Person,
related_name='relationships_as_source',
on_delete=models.CASCADE,
blank=False,
null=False)
#: Person with whom the relationship is reported
target = models.ForeignKey(Person,
related_name='relationships_as_target',
on_delete=models.CASCADE,
blank=False,
null=False)
@property
def current_answers(self) -> typing.Optional['RelationshipAnswerSet']:
try:
answer_set = self.answer_sets.latest()
if answer_set.is_current:
return answer_set
except RelationshipAnswerSet.DoesNotExist:
# No AnswerSet created yet
pass
return None
@property
def is_current(self) -> bool:
return self.current_answers is not None
def get_absolute_url(self):
return reverse('people:relationship.detail', kwargs={'pk': self.pk})
def __str__(self) -> str:
return f'{self.source} -> {self.target}'
@property
def reverse(self):
"""
Get the reverse of this relationship.
@raise Relationship.DoesNotExist: When the reverse relationship is not known
"""
return type(self).objects.get(source=self.target, target=self.source)
class RelationshipAnswerSet(AnswerSet):
"""The answers to the relationship questions at a particular point in time."""
question_model = RelationshipQuestion
#: Relationship to which this answer set belongs
relationship = models.ForeignKey(Relationship,
on_delete=models.CASCADE,
related_name='answer_sets',
blank=False,
null=False)
#: Answers to :class:`RelationshipQuestion`s
question_answers = models.ManyToManyField(RelationshipQuestionChoice)
def get_absolute_url(self):
return self.relationship.get_absolute_url()
class OrganisationRelationshipQuestion(Question):
"""Question which may be asked about an :class:`OrganisationRelationship`."""
class OrganisationRelationshipQuestionChoice(QuestionChoice):
"""Allowed answer to a :class:`OrganisationRelationshipQuestion`."""
#: Question to which this answer belongs
question = models.ForeignKey(OrganisationRelationshipQuestion,
related_name='answers',
on_delete=models.CASCADE,
blank=False,
null=False)
class Meta(QuestionChoice.Meta):
constraints = [
models.UniqueConstraint(fields=['question', 'text'],
name='unique_question_answer_organisationrelationshipquestionchoice')
]
class OrganisationRelationship(models.Model):
"""A directional relationship between a person and an organisation with linked questions."""
class Meta:
constraints = [
models.UniqueConstraint(fields=['source', 'target'],
name='unique_relationship_modelorganisationrelationship'),
]
#: Person reporting the relationship
source = models.ForeignKey(
Person,
related_name='organisation_relationships_as_source',
on_delete=models.CASCADE,
blank=False,
null=False)
#: Organisation with which the relationship is reported
target = models.ForeignKey(
Organisation,
related_name='organisation_relationships_as_target',
on_delete=models.CASCADE,
blank=False,
null=False)
@property
def current_answers(self) -> typing.Optional['OrganisationRelationshipAnswerSet']:
try:
answer_set = self.answer_sets.latest()
if answer_set.is_current:
return answer_set
except OrganisationRelationshipAnswerSet.DoesNotExist:
# No AnswerSet created yet
pass
return None
@property
def is_current(self) -> bool:
return self.current_answers is not None
def get_absolute_url(self):
return reverse('people:organisation.relationship.detail',
kwargs={'pk': self.pk})
def __str__(self) -> str:
return f'{self.source} -> {self.target}'
class OrganisationRelationshipAnswerSet(AnswerSet):
"""The answers to the organisation relationship questions at a particular point in time."""
question_model = OrganisationRelationshipQuestion
#: OrganisationRelationship to which this answer set belongs
relationship = models.ForeignKey(OrganisationRelationship,
on_delete=models.CASCADE,
related_name='answer_sets',
blank=False,
null=False)
#: Answers to :class:`OrganisationRelationshipQuestion`s
question_answers = models.ManyToManyField(
OrganisationRelationshipQuestionChoice)
def get_absolute_url(self):
return self.relationship.get_absolute_url()
